Transaction bf2950aaa9834851cf0881c3f47d4e3e4a21cb9d503cf785015a625f15456176
1 Input
1 Output
-
bf2950aaa9834851cf0881c3f47d4e3e4a21cb9d503cf785015a625f15456176:0
- value
- 150856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ad995f1de2df8c5e1884706f5fb0dfe99c25853 OP_EQUAL
- address
- 3EMBq8vHLHhQ1FsnQTgDb2gHSsUwErP1iE